Simcoe Summer Ale

Partial Mash Recipe

Batch Size: 5.00 galStyle: American Pale Ale (10A)
Boil Size: 2.82 galStyle Guide: BJCP 2008
Color: 8.3 SRMEquipment: Pot ( 3 Gal/11.4 L) - Extract
Bitterness: 36.5 IBUsBoil Time: 60 min
Est OG: 1.049 (12.3° P)Mash Profile: Single Infusion, Light Body, Batch Sparge
Est FG: 1.012 SG (3.0° P)Fermentation: My Aging Profile
ABV: 5.0%Taste Rating: 30.0

Ingredients
Amount Name Type #
3 lbs 8.00 oz Pale Malt (2 Row) US (2.0 SRM) Grain 1
1 lbs Carapils (Briess) (1.5 SRM) Grain 2
8.00 oz Caramel/Crystal Malt - 90L (90.0 SRM) Grain 3
4.00 oz Honey Malt (25.0 SRM) Grain 4
3 lbs LME Pilsen Light (Briess) [Boil] (2.3 SRM) Extract 5
0.50 oz Simcoe [13.0%] - Boil 60 min Hops 6
1.00 items Whirlfloc Tablet (Boil 15 min) Misc 7
1.00 oz Opal [8.6%] - Boil 10 min Hops 8
1.00 oz Amarillo Gold [8.8%] - Boil 5 min Hops 9
1.50 oz Simcoe [12.7%] - Steep 15 min Hops 10
1.0 pkgs California Ale (White Labs #WLP001) Yeast 11
